  • Question: Can I program the System Board using popular programming languages?

    Answer: Yes, the System Board is compatible with various programming languages, including VHDL and Verilog, which are commonly used for FPGA programming. Additionally, it can integrate with development environments like Quartus Prime for design entry and simulation. This versatility allows engineers and hobbyists to leverage their existing knowledge in digital design, making it a suitable choice for both beginners and advanced users. Moreover, users can utilize C/C++ through High-Level Synthesis (HLS) to target the FPGA for customized applications.

  • Question: Does the FPGA board support any specific operating systems?

    Answer: The System Board does not run a full operating system like a computer; instead, FPGAs are programmed to perform specific tasks or functions based on user-defined configurations. However, it can interface with microcontrollers or microprocessor systems that run various operating systems like Linux or RTOS (Real-Time Operating Systems). This capability allows for the development of embedded systems where the FPGA handles specific hardware tasks while a processor manages high-level software execution.
